Learning Objectives

4 objectives
  • Understand the basic terminology and concepts of human anatomy and physiology.
  • Identify and describe the major organ systems of the human body and their primary functions.
  • Explain how different body systems interact to maintain homeostasis and support life.
  • Develop foundational knowledge to apply in health sciences and biological studies.

Unit 196: Human Anatomy and Physiology

1. Introduction to Human Anatomy and Physiology

  • Overview of anatomy (structure) and physiology (function)
  • Anatomical terminology: directional terms, body planes, and cavities
  • Levels of structural organization: cells, tissues, organs, systems
  • Homeostasis and its importance

2. Skeletal System

  • Functions of the skeletal system: support, protection, movement, mineral storage, blood cell production
  • Bone structure and types
  • Joints: classification and movement types
  • Associated tissues: cartilage, ligaments

3. Muscular System

  • Types of muscle tissue: skeletal, cardiac, smooth
  • Muscle anatomy: muscle fibers, myofibrils
  • Mechanism of muscle contraction
  • Roles of muscles: movement, posture maintenance, heat generation

4. Cardiovascular System

  • Components: heart, blood vessels (arteries, veins, capillaries), blood
  • Structure and function of the heart
  • Circulatory pathways: systemic and pulmonary circulation
  • Transport of oxygen, nutrients, and waste products

5. Respiratory System

  • Anatomy: nasal cavity, pharynx, larynx, trachea, bronchi, lungs
  • Mechanism of breathing: inhalation and exhalation
  • Gas exchange process in alveoli
  • Regulation of respiration

6. Digestive System

  • Major organs: mouth, esophagus, stomach, small and large intestines, liver, pancreas
  • Processes: ingestion, digestion, absorption, elimination
  • Role of accessory organs
  • Nutrient absorption and metabolism

7. Nervous System

  • Central nervous system: brain and spinal cord
  • Peripheral nervous system: nerves and ganglia
  • Neuron structure and function
  • Nervous system roles: sensory input, integration, motor output

8. Endocrine System

  • Overview of endocrine glands: pituitary, thyroid, adrenal, pancreas, etc.
  • Hormones and their mechanisms of action
  • Regulation of growth, metabolism, and reproduction
  • Feedback mechanisms

9. Urinary System

  • Components: kidneys, ureters, bladder, urethra
  • Functions: urine formation, filtration, reabsorption, secretion
  • Role in fluid and electrolyte balance
  • Regulation of blood pressure and pH

10. Reproductive System

  • Male reproductive anatomy and function
  • Female reproductive anatomy and function
  • Hormonal regulation of reproductive processes
  • Overview of human reproduction and development
